Product Introduction

CNBM ductile iron pipe ranges from DN80-DN1600mm (Tyton, T-Type, Class K7/K8/K9), effective length: 6m, complying with ISO2531and EN545 standards.


Specification& Payment terms

Internal lining:      ductile iron pipes shall have an internal cement mortar lining in acc with ISO4179.


External coating:  ductile iron pipes shall be externally coated with metallic zinc spray plus a further layer of resin painting to ISO8179.

Gasket:              100% SBR/NBR/EPDM rubber gasket in accordance with ISO4633.

Packing:             ductile iron pipes from DN100 to DN300 be bundled with steel belts, others are in bulk.

Q: What is the difference between a cast iron pipe and a ductile iron pipe?
Nodular cast iron has high strength and strong plasticity. The tensile strength of ductile iron is twice that of gray iron, and the yield strength even exceeds that of cast steel.

Q: Can ductile iron pipe be used for underground applications?
Indeed, underground applications can employ ductile iron pipe. Renowned for its robustness and endurance, ductile iron pipe proves to be well-suited for a multitude of underground uses, including water and sewage systems, gas pipelines, and irrigation systems. Its exceptional resistance to corrosion and external burdens renders it a dependable selection for underground installations, where sustained functionality and structural soundness are pivotal considerations. Moreover, ductile iron pipe's pliability enables it to endure ground shifting and settling sans fracturing or shattering, making it an apt choice for regions susceptible to seismic occurrences.
